About the company

Spheria Emerging Companies Limited operates as an investment company in Australia. It provides investors with access to a portfolio of Australian and New Zealand small- and micro-cap securities. The company was incorporated in 2017 and is based in Sydney, Australia.

Revenue & earnings trend

FY2021 – FY2025 · reported fiscal years

Spheria Emerging Companies Limited reported revenue of A$24.2M in FY2025 versus A$58.1M in FY2021, a compound −19.6%/yr. Reported net income was A$16.4M in FY2025, compounding −20.1%/yr from FY2021.

How we calculate Fair Value

Each company is valued through a stack of independent intrinsic-value models (DCF variants, residual-income, multiples and more), blended into one family-balanced consensus and weighted by how much trustworthy data backs it. A separate quality layer scores the fundamentals. Every input is real reported data — nothing guessed.
